Today I have this gorgeous fall wreath made with Impression Obsession Leaves die....this die comes with 5 different leaves, and I have used 4 today, each cut 4 times.  The leaves have been painted with
different tones of color from Autumn Brilliance Twinkling H2Os...oh my, these are so fun and easy to work with and add such a gorgeous "twinkle".


I kept my card, though layered, rather simple so the focus is on the wreath itself.  Each leaf was mounted with Joy Foam Pads small.  My wreath is mounted on one of my very favorite Cheery Lynn Designs die called French Pastry.  This is a beautiful, but intricate die and I can highly recommend the Cuttlehug and Crafters Tools both by Cheery Lynn Designs to enable you to have a perfect cut every time!!

The background paper under the wreath is a lovely design from Simple Stories called Vintage Bliss.
It is a stunning 6 x 6 paper pad, even the little butterfly you see is from the pack.

Today I am showing you two alike, but very different cards using some of the

 
 
Cheery Lynn Designs build a flower and embellishment dies....
these dies contain numerous petals, bases
and leaves to build an endless "garden of flowers"
One of the easiest flowers to make is a Lily...goodness, there are so many colors of lilies
it is hard to choose one!!
Both flowers were "built" using the dies listed below:
 
The orange flower was colored with Tim Holtz Distress Ink Markers.
The colors used were Spiced Marmalade, Rusty Hinge, and Dried Marigold
Did you know that Classy Cards and Such has a wonderful marker club you can join to get all
the fab marker colors?  There are also 12 "new colors" you can preorder now!!
 
 
The Pink flowers were colored with Pan Pastels.
 
 
Both cards have the gorgeous Memory Box Quinn Flourish under the Lily
and the Spellbinders Classic Edges 2 for trim....
 
 
The paper used on the pink card is from Kaiser Craft called "The Lake House"
The paper used on the orange card is Graphic 45 Secret Garden.....the one in stock
is a bit different, but just as beautiful!!
